ยินดีต้อนรับคุณ, บุคคลทั่วไป กรุณา เข้าสู่ระบบ หรือ ลงทะเบียน

เข้าสู่ระบบด้วยชื่อผู้ใช้ รหัสผ่าน และระยะเวลาในเซสชั่น

หน้า: [1]   ลงล่าง
พิมพ์
ผู้เขียน หัวข้อ: [C++] สมองระเบิด  (อ่าน 2007 ครั้ง)
0 สมาชิก และ 1 บุคคลทั่วไป กำลังดูหัวข้อนี้
แก๊ว. ..*
Verified Seller
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 106
ออฟไลน์ ออฟไลน์

กระทู้: 1,573



ดูรายละเอียด
« เมื่อ: 28 ตุลาคม 2010, 17:58:47 »

ผมลองรันแล้ว พอใส่ คะแนนไป กด Enter ปุ๊บ โปรแกรมปิดเฉยๆ เลยฮะ

อาจารย์ที่ เรียนเขาเพิ่งสอน Cin + count ไป ครับ ผมต้องมีงานส่งเป็นโปรแกรม ตัดเกรด ครับ  wanwan011 ผมลองเอา Code มาให้ดู ครับ

โค๊ด:
#include <iostream.h>

int main()
{
    int score;
   
    cout << "Enter your score : " << endl;
    cin >> score;

    if(score >= 80)
{
cout << "Your grad A" ;
;
}
    else if(score >= 70 )
{
cout << "Your grad B " ;
;
}
    else if(score >= 60)
{
cout << "Your grad C " ;
;
}
    else if(score >= 50)
{
cout << "Your grad D " ;
;
}
    else if(score <= 49)
{
cout << "Your grad F " ;
;
}
    else
{
cout << "End Program." ;
}

return 0;

}


ใครพอแนะแนวทางได้มั่งครับ
บันทึกการเข้า

รับงาน Data Warehouse, Python, .NET C#
namspitez
สมุนแก๊งเสียว
*

พลังน้ำใจ: 246
ออฟไลน์ ออฟไลน์

กระทู้: 725



ดูรายละเอียด เว็บไซต์
« ตอบ #1 เมื่อ: 28 ตุลาคม 2010, 18:04:32 »

ลองใส่ getch();
ต่อ return 0;

ลองดูครับ
บันทึกการเข้า

แก๊ว. ..*
Verified Seller
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 106
ออฟไลน์ ออฟไลน์

กระทู้: 1,573



ดูรายละเอียด
« ตอบ #2 เมื่อ: 28 ตุลาคม 2010, 18:11:52 »

ลองใส่ getch();
ต่อ return 0;

ลองดูครับ


Error อ่าครับ
โค๊ด:
#include <iostream.h>
int main()
{
clrscr();
    int score;
   
    cout << "Enter your score : " << endl;
    cin >> score;

    if(score >= 80)
{
cout << "Your grad A" ;
;
}
    else if(score >= 70 )
{
cout << "Your grad B " ;
;
}
    else if(score >= 60)
{
cout << "Your grad C " ;
;
}
    else if(score >= 50)
{
cout << "Your grad D " ;
;
}
    else if(score <= 49)
{
cout << "Your grad F " ;
;}
    else
{
cout << "End Program." ; }
getch();
return 0;

}
บันทึกการเข้า

รับงาน Data Warehouse, Python, .NET C#
Moyzier
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 161
ออฟไลน์ ออฟไลน์

กระทู้: 2,212



ดูรายละเอียด เว็บไซต์
« ตอบ #3 เมื่อ: 28 ตุลาคม 2010, 18:15:03 »

ผมเพิ่งเรียน qbasic ไปคับ


หลักการทำงานของมันก้อ รับ คะแนนมา แล้ว เอามาทำ ตามที่ท่านทำแหละ คือ ใส่ไปทีละ ชั้น 49 50 60 70 80

คือ อิฟ กับ เอลฟ์


ไม่รู้มันเหมือนกันป่าว แค่อยากแชร์ความรุ้ะครับ

---

ว่าแต่มันต้องใส่ # หรือ $ ตามหลังตัวเลขหรือปล่าวครับ อิอิ ถ้าเหมือนกันก้อคนใช่
บันทึกการเข้า

xvlnw.com
Verified Seller
เจ้าพ่อบอร์ดเสียว
*

พลังน้ำใจ: 493
ออฟไลน์ ออฟไลน์

กระทู้: 5,905



ดูรายละเอียด เว็บไซต์
« ตอบ #4 เมื่อ: 28 ตุลาคม 2010, 18:16:16 »

มันมีตัว ; เกินหรือปล่าวครับ ลองดู จบคำสั่ง มีแค่อันเดียวพอครับ
บันทึกการเข้า

Putter™
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 421
ออฟไลน์ ออฟไลน์

กระทู้: 2,103



ดูรายละเอียด เว็บไซต์
« ตอบ #5 เมื่อ: 28 ตุลาคม 2010, 18:19:32 »

โค๊ด:
#include <iostream>
using namespace std;

int main()
{
    int score;
   
    cout << "Enter your score : " ;
    cin >> score;

    if(score >= 80)
{
cout << "Your grad A" ;
}
    else if(score >= 70 )
{
cout << "Your grad B " ;
}
    else if(score >= 60)
{
cout << "Your grad C " ;
}
    else if(score >= 50)
{
cout << "Your grad D " ;
}
    else if(score <= 49)
{
cout << "Your grad F " ;
}
    else
{
cout << "End Program." ;
}

return (0);

}

ประมาณนี้ครับ
บันทึกการเข้า

Ruk-Com Hosting (IAAS)
Ruk-Com Cloud (PAAS)
รีวิวโฮสติ่ง Ruk-Com  จากสมาชิก THAISEO

ไม่พอใจยินดีคืนเงินเต็มจำนวนทุกบริการ
แก๊ว. ..*
Verified Seller
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 106
ออฟไลน์ ออฟไลน์

กระทู้: 1,573



ดูรายละเอียด
« ตอบ #6 เมื่อ: 28 ตุลาคม 2010, 18:19:55 »

บอกตรงๆเลย c++ นี่ ผมโง่ เลยครับ ยังไม่รู้เรื่องไรเลยครับ

คิดว่าตอนนี้ยังไม่พร้อมที่จะรับมันด้วย เพราะเวป ผมก็ยังเป็นไม่หมด
บันทึกการเข้า

รับงาน Data Warehouse, Python, .NET C#
phathomyoyo
ก๊วนเสียว
*

พลังน้ำใจ: 43
ออฟไลน์ ออฟไลน์

กระทู้: 223



ดูรายละเอียด เว็บไซต์
« ตอบ #7 เมื่อ: 28 ตุลาคม 2010, 18:21:20 »

>< ได้แต่ภาษา C  C++ ยังไม่เรียน  Embarrassed
บันทึกการเข้า

รับจ้างเขียน E-MAIL ภาษาอังกฤษ จะให้แปลหรือเขียนก็ได้ครับ ราคาตกลงกันได้ ^^  สนใจ PM มาได้เลยครับผม

หาผู้สนับสนุน Banner ครับ เว็บนอก USA เกี่ยวกับเรื่องลึกลับ UIP 1000+ ต่อวันครับ

รับติวสอบเซอร์ Microsoft , CISCO , ORACLE , IBM , COBOL ฯลฯ
แก๊ว. ..*
Verified Seller
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 106
ออฟไลน์ ออฟไลน์

กระทู้: 1,573



ดูรายละเอียด
« ตอบ #8 เมื่อ: 28 ตุลาคม 2010, 18:23:02 »

ถ้ารันไม่ติดนี่ เกี่ยวกับ บางโปรแกรมหรือป่าวครับ ที่อาจารย์สอน เขาใช้ Turbo c++ อ่ะครับ
บันทึกการเข้า

รับงาน Data Warehouse, Python, .NET C#
deadclosed
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 133
ออฟไลน์ ออฟไลน์

กระทู้: 1,553



ดูรายละเอียด เว็บไซต์
« ตอบ #9 เมื่อ: 28 ตุลาคม 2010, 18:23:16 »

เข้าหม้อหมดล่ะ
C++ C

 Tongue Tongue
บันทึกการเข้า
phathomyoyo
ก๊วนเสียว
*

พลังน้ำใจ: 43
ออฟไลน์ ออฟไลน์

กระทู้: 223



ดูรายละเอียด เว็บไซต์
« ตอบ #10 เมื่อ: 28 ตุลาคม 2010, 18:24:18 »

Compiler ก็มีผลนะครับ
Turbo C++ ปัญหาน้อยสุดและ
บันทึกการเข้า

รับจ้างเขียน E-MAIL ภาษาอังกฤษ จะให้แปลหรือเขียนก็ได้ครับ ราคาตกลงกันได้ ^^  สนใจ PM มาได้เลยครับผม

หาผู้สนับสนุน Banner ครับ เว็บนอก USA เกี่ยวกับเรื่องลึกลับ UIP 1000+ ต่อวันครับ

รับติวสอบเซอร์ Microsoft , CISCO , ORACLE , IBM , COBOL ฯลฯ
Putter™
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 421
ออฟไลน์ ออฟไลน์

กระทู้: 2,103



ดูรายละเอียด เว็บไซต์
« ตอบ #11 เมื่อ: 28 ตุลาคม 2010, 18:26:33 »

ผมใช้ Microsoft Visual Studio อ่าครับ

รู้สึกว่า turboc ลอง

โค๊ด:
#include <iostream.h>
#include<conio.h>

int main()
{
    int score;
   
    cout << "Enter your score : " ;
    cin >> score;

    if(score >= 80)
{
cout << "Your grad A" ;
}
    else if(score >= 70 )
{
cout << "Your grad B " ;
}
    else if(score >= 60)
{
cout << "Your grad C " ;
}
    else if(score >= 50)
{
cout << "Your grad D " ;
}
    else if(score <= 49)
{
cout << "Your grad F " ;
}
    else
{
cout << "End Program." ;
}

getch();

return (0);

}
บันทึกการเข้า

Ruk-Com Hosting (IAAS)
Ruk-Com Cloud (PAAS)
รีวิวโฮสติ่ง Ruk-Com  จากสมาชิก THAISEO

ไม่พอใจยินดีคืนเงินเต็มจำนวนทุกบริการ
แก๊ว. ..*
Verified Seller
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 106
ออฟไลน์ ออฟไลน์

กระทู้: 1,573



ดูรายละเอียด
« ตอบ #12 เมื่อ: 28 ตุลาคม 2010, 18:26:47 »

โค๊ด:
#include <iostream>
using namespace std;

int main()
{
    int score;
   
    cout << "Enter your score : " ;
    cin >> score;

    if(score >= 80)
{
cout << "Your grad A" ;
}
    else if(score >= 70 )
{
cout << "Your grad B " ;
}
    else if(score >= 60)
{
cout << "Your grad C " ;
}
    else if(score >= 50)
{
cout << "Your grad D " ;
}
    else if(score <= 49)
{
cout << "Your grad F " ;
}
    else
{
cout << "End Program." ;
}

return (0);

}

ประมาณนี้ครับ

ผมลองตัวนี้ เติม .h ไปหลัง iostream ครับ error  1 ตัว แต่ถ้าไม่เติม หลายตัวจะ Error หรือผมมั่วไปเองป่าวครับ  Lips Sealed
บันทึกการเข้า

รับงาน Data Warehouse, Python, .NET C#
แก๊ว. ..*
Verified Seller
หัวหน้าแก๊งเสียว
*

พลังน้ำใจ: 106
ออฟไลน์ ออฟไลน์

กระทู้: 1,573



ดูรายละเอียด
« ตอบ #13 เมื่อ: 28 ตุลาคม 2010, 18:28:01 »

ผมใช้ Microsoft Visual Studio อ่าครับ

รู้สึกว่า turboc ลอง

โค๊ด:
#include <iostream.h>
#include<conio.h>

int main()
{
    int score;
   
    cout << "Enter your score : " ;
    cin >> score;

    if(score >= 80)
{
cout << "Your grad A" ;
}
    else if(score >= 70 )
{
cout << "Your grad B " ;
}
    else if(score >= 60)
{
cout << "Your grad C " ;
}
    else if(score >= 50)
{
cout << "Your grad D " ;
}
    else if(score <= 49)
{
cout << "Your grad F " ;
}
    else
{
cout << "End Program." ;
}

getch();

return (0);

}

ติดเลยครับ

ขอบคุณ ทุกท่านๆ มากครับ จัดงามๆ 1 Thx  wanwan017
บันทึกการเข้า

รับงาน Data Warehouse, Python, .NET C#
admev
ก๊วนเสียว
*

พลังน้ำใจ: 19
ออฟไลน์ ออฟไลน์

กระทู้: 270



ดูรายละเอียด
« ตอบ #14 เมื่อ: 29 ตุลาคม 2010, 12:41:39 »

ใช้แต่ของ DEVC คับ ใช้งานง่ายดี

http://www.bloodshed.net/devcpp.html

แต่พอไม่ได้เขียนนานก็ลืม  Embarrassed Embarrassed Embarrassed
บันทึกการเข้า

ต้องการเครื่องปั๊มนม? ขายเครื่องปั๊มนม เครื่องปั๊มนม อะไหล่เครื่องปั๊มนม เครื่องปั๊มนมไฟฟ้า

เครื่องปั๊มนม ความรู้เกี่ยวกับนมแม่ การปั๊มนม วิธีการใช้เครื่องปั๊มนม
หน้า: [1]   ขึ้นบน
พิมพ์